The natural resource that became more available to the American public as a result of railroad expansion is coal.

As a result of rail road expansion, it was discovered that coal can be used as a source of energy which was also the most cost efficient at that time.

Using coal made transport easier across the states since most coal mines were found in the west and thus became one of the major industries in the United States.
